Islamabad: President Asif Ali Zardari and Prime Minister Mohammad Shehbaz Sharif have expressed deep sorrow over the loss of life and widespread displacement caused by severe flooding across Southeast Asia. The President acknowledged the tragedy, which has claimed hundreds of lives and left many missing, as a source of great distress for the people of Pakistan. He conveyed heartfelt condolences to the families who have lost loved ones and to the governments and people of Indonesia, Malaysia, and Thailand.
According to Radio Pakistan, the President emphasized that Pakistan will remain closely engaged with regional partners and international organizations to explore practical ways to offer support within its means. He assured that Pakistan stands by the affected countries as they navigate this crisis and prayed for the departed and for the safe recovery of those missing.
The Prime Minister, in his message, echoed similar sentiments, praying for the safe return of those still missing and for the swift recovery of all affected communities. He stated that Pakistan stands in solidarity with the people, governments, and leadership of Indonesia, Malaysia, and Thailand in this hour of grief.
